Compute the … WebContinuation-passing style. make all recursive calls tail calls by packaging up any work remaining after the would be recursive call into an explicit continuation and passing it to the recursive call. make the implicit continuation capture by call/cc explicit by packaging it as an additional procedural argument passed in every call. this is ... WebTail recursion is a form of linear recursion. In tail recursion, the recursive call is the last thing the function does. Often, the value of the recursive call is returned. WebApr 6, 2014 · Recursion is suited to problems where we don't know how many partial results there will be. An example is where we are summing the elements of a binary tree (that does not have links to the parent nodes) - we need to keep the sum calculated so far and be able to ascend the tree.
